#7e6c74 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e6c74 is composed of 49.4% red, 42.4%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.3% magenta, 7.9%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 333.3 degrees, a saturation of 7.7% and a lightness of 45.9%. #7e6c74 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cd8e8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#7e6c74 color description : Dark grayish pink.
#7e6c74 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e6c74 has RGB values of R:126, G:108,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.08,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8285300.

							Shades and Tints of #7e6c74
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0809 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
